iSwiss Collet Protects Sensitive Parts During Machining
PMTS 2025: The Gold Wave Collet product line is designed to prevent scratching and help preserve the finish of sensitive parts.

showcases its Gold Wave Collet product line, which includes profile collets, vulcanized collets, wave/kroko slots, super grip and extended nose. The products are specialized to prevent scratching and help preserve the finish of sensitive parts. The outer part of the collet is made from steel to keep flexibility and longevity, but the hard, wear-resistant aluminium bronze pads are the contact point. It also has narrow wave slots, which prevent contaminants from entering the collet that could scratch sensitive parts. This collet is commonly used on applications for titanium alloys and cobalt chrome alloys or precious metals like gold and platinum. The Gold Wave Collet option is available for all main and sub collet types.
iSwiss Corp. is a supplier of high-quality toolholding and workholding as well as cutting tools for Swiss-type machines. The company provides workpiece and tool clamping, toolholders for cutting tools, reduction sleeves and boring bar sleeves, insert systems, spindle attachments, live toolholders, coolant delivery systems as well as CoolSpeed mini systems, automated parts carousels and MiJet cleaning equipment.
